Dissolution of the rock's primary ingredient, calcium carbonate, by water slightly acidified by absorbed atmospheric carbon-dioxide and percolating through the rock bulk's joints and other discontinuities. Eventually the network of initial tiny conduits will start to coalesce and capture, leading to discrete passages forming.

How do stalactites in limestone caverns most likely form?

The limestone caverns themselves are formed by groundwater gradually dissolving the limestone rock. In this process, some of the limestone is taken into solution, and under favourable conditions, it will form a drip on the roof of a cavern. This may eventually build to form a stalactite above, and perhaps also a stalagmite below it.


Caverns most commonly form in what type of bedrock?

Caverns most commonly form in limestone bedrock, which is made of calcite minerals that can be dissolved by slightly acidic groundwater over time. This process creates underground cavities and passageways that can grow into large cavern systems.


Why do caverns and sinkholes form?

Caverns form through the gradual dissolution of limestone by acidic groundwater, creating underground openings. Sinkholes occur when the roof of these caverns collapse, or when there is a sudden collapse of the surface layer due to erosion of underlying material like limestone or salt deposits. Both geological processes are commonly found in areas with soluble bedrock.

Do most caverns form above the water table?

No, most caverns form below the water table. Caverns are typically formed by the dissolution of underground limestone or other soluble rocks by water, and this process usually occurs below the water table where the rocks are saturated with water.


What are the Linville caverns?

The Linville Caverns are a network of limestone caves located in North Carolina, USA. They are open to the public for guided tours, offering a chance to see unique geological formations such as stalactites and stalagmites. The caverns are known for their underground streams and spectacular rock formations.

How and where do most caverns form?

Most caverns form through a process called speleogenesis, which occurs when groundwater dissolves limestone or other soluble rocks over millions of years. These dissolved materials create openings and passages underground, eventually forming caverns. The most common locations for cavern formation are in areas with thick limestone deposits, such as karst regions.

What dissolves limestone and forms caves or caverns?

Carbonic acid, which forms when rainwater combines with carbon dioxide in the atmosphere, dissolves limestone over time to form caves and caverns. This process, known as chemical weathering, gradually dissolves the calcium carbonate in limestone to create underground voids and unique geological formations.
